A recent survey of retail spending and trends commissioned by Deloitte & Touche USA concludes that gift cards will continue to be the top gift purchase this holiday season. The report notes that approximately 66 percent of consumers are planning to buy an average of 4.6 gift cards (up from 3.9 in 2005).

As stores gear up for these post-Thanksgiving shoppers, Book Sense sends a reminder to make sure that all cash-wrap staff is trained to activate and redeem gift cards and that they know what to do if they encounter a technical problem.
